Python 之輸出format格式化

2021-10-07 13:34:48 字數 648 閱讀 9843

python使用format進行格式化輸出:

1、使用槽{}的概念進行格式化輸出。

print("這是格式化輸出的例項,年月日".format(nian,yue,ri)

上面有3個槽,編號依次為0,1,2分別對應format中的nian,yue.ri.三個變數。

2、擴充套件,對應以上三個變數,我們可以內定改變其編號。

print("這是格式化輸出的例項,年月日".format(nian,yue,ri)。

3、槽內能放置的6類控制型變數。

分別是填充型別、對齊型別、寬度長度、(千位分隔符)、(精度表示)、(型別表示)。

放置的位置排序。

填充型別:可以是任何符號,如#,%,&,@,=等任意的符號。

對齊型別:《表示左對齊,>表示右對齊,^表示居中對齊。

寬度長度:數字,表示輸出所佔的位數。

千位分隔符:即用,表示每到3位加乙個,符號用來進行分割。

精度表示:用.n表示小數字精確到第n位,即保留n個有效數字。

型別表示:b二進位制表示,c,按照unicode編碼表示,d十進位制表示,o表示八進位制表示,e表示科學技術發表示,%表示按百分比  表示。

4、使用編號可以對乙個資料進行多次重複輸出。

print(",,,:0:x}".format(1200))

Python筆記之format 格式輸出全解

格式化輸出 format format 把傳統的 替換為 來實現格式化輸出 使用位置引數 就是在字串中把需要輸出的變數值用 來代替,然後用format 來修改使之成為想要的字串,位置引數就是把傳統的 改為 按照位置順序自動進行替換 my name is age format anxc 18 my n...

python 格式輸出( 用法和format)

今天修改程式,比較糾結用哪個,搜資料整理一下。format 用法相對於基本格式 的用法,功能要強大很多。將字串當成模板,通過傳入的引數進行格式化,並且使用大括號 作為特殊字元代替 correct print the number is d 20 輸出 the number is 20 error p...

python格式化輸出 format

對於很多時候,題目要求你要去保留小數點後幾位小數,或者是整數按位輸出,不足補0,python中提供的format函式能夠讓你輕鬆地實現。format函式有兩個引數,含義如下 1.第乙個引數為要格式化的數字 2.第二個引數為格式化字串。format的返回值就是數字格式化後的字串。num 1234.56...